Home » A Guide to Start a Career as A Big Data Engineer

A Guide to Start a Career as A Big Data Engineer

Veronica May 7, 2023

BigDataScalability.com – A big data engineer can be one prospective career choice in the future if you are interested in numbers, graphs, data, analytics, and IT. Although it is now less popular than data scientists and data analysts, this position is irreplaceable in the data economy.

Data engineers focus on making data accessible to various users. It enables organizations to use those reliable data for different purposes. To have this career position, you need to have education and experience related to the field.

Working with other professionals in data-related roles also helps you to get a certificate. Hence, you can work in this position professionally.

6 Critical Aspects of Being a Big Data Engineer

Here are critical aspects that you should know about a data engineer. It helps you to get a better idea about this career and consider whether it is right for you. You can discover what data engineers are, what they do, their job opportunities, and how to become a big data engineer.

1. What Are Big Data Engineers?

What-Are-Big-Data-Engineers

Big data engineers are professionals who work by developing, maintaining, examining, analyzing, and evaluating big data from various sources. Data engineering skill has a vital role in tech-driven organizations. Their main goal is to save, store, and distribute reliable data across an organization.

Big data denotes massive and complex data sets. Collecting large volumes of data is a common task for companies from different sources. It is because companies need big data to conduct business operations. Effective use of big data helps organizations to increase profitability and improve efficiency.

It also can enhance the scalability of the organizations. However, big data will not serve its powerful effects if no professional works with it. Organizations need a skillful person that can help building a system by containing, maintaining, and extracting data.

A big data engineer has an ultimate responsibility to help organizations manage their big data. Without this position, no bridge connects big data and suitable databases. It is an ability that a data engineer has to unlock the hidden potential or hidden pattern brought by big data.

2. Big Data Engineers’ Function

Big-Data-Engineers-Function

Although they have similar work with big data, there are differences between data engineers and other data-related roles. The primary function of this role is managing and maintaining big data infrastructures.

The tasks include collecting, storing, processing, and distributing reliable data across organizations or companies. There is a powerful development aspect to be big data engineers.

Hence, it is common to see data engineers begin their careers in related roles such as software developers. They choose positions that require specific skills on what this job implicates.

3. Responsibilities of Big Data Engineers

Responsibilities-of-Big-Data-Engineers

As you know the standard tasks of a big data engineer, you are probably curious about how their daily job looks like. To give you more understanding, here are several responsibilities in big data engineering.

  • Designing, creating, and managing Extract Transform Load operations and channels for various data sources.
  • Optimize and improve previous data quality and data control processes to boost stability and performance.
  • Create and implement software systems for more effective data collecting and processing.
  • Manage, maintain, and improve prior data warehouse and data solutions by maximizing programming languages and tools.
  • Build modified tools and algorithms for data science and data analytics work.
  • Design data architectures to meet business requirements.
  • Work together with software developers and business intelligence teams to propose strategic objectives for data models.
  • Collaborate with advanced IT team to manage bigger infrastructures.
  • Explore new data-related technology and methods of collecting valuable data to improve the capacity of organizations and maintain competitive work.

4. Required Skills for Big Data Engineers

Required-Skills-for-Big-Data-Engineers

To work as a big data engineer professionally, you should have the following skills.

  • You have a computer science degree or other data-related degrees.
  • You have a strong technical background. It includes adequate knowledge in many programming languages and passion for code writing.
  • You own a good understanding of data-related tasks such as data streaming, data replication, data integration, virtualization, and so forth.
  • You experience working in data management or software management positions.
  • You have practical experience in using programming languages like Python and SQL. You must understand big data technologies such as the Apache Stack.
  • You experience working with interactive database management systems like MySQL and PostgreSQL.

Big data engineer commonly has natural skills such as critical thinking and problem solving to help them complete the tasks. However, more practical skills like programming languages and different technologies are learnable. 

Hence, if you want to start a career in data engineering but have no experience in those required skills, then challenge yourself to learn them. You can begin by choosing one skill that you want to master and familiarize yourself with that skill through learning.

5. How Much Is Big Data Engineer’s Salary?

How-Much-Is-Big-Data-Engineers-Salary

Before achieving a specific career position, people like to consider its salary. Similarly, many people wonder about the earning of becoming data engineers. Various factors affect on how much data engineers can get such as work experience, geographic location, and job title.

Even the company where they work also affects the total salary they earn. For instance, when looking at numerous salary comparison sites, the average earning received by big data engineers in the United States is around $108K per year. However, the amount can vary from one state to another.

It is because there are also states that pay big data engineers around $131K per year. The real amount still can increase such as when it includes bonus and geographic weighting. That is a reason why a big data engineer who works in Europe can earn a higher amount of salary.

When compared to other data-related roles, there are no significant differences in salary estimation. It is because the average amount of salary for data analysts in the United States is $77K. Meanwhile, data scientists in the United States can produce the average amount of $132K.

6. How to Get Started to Be Big Data Engineers

How-to-Get-Started-to-Be-Big-Data-Engineers

You have understood what big data engineers do along with their responsibilities. You also understand their required skills and the amount of salary they could earn. However, you might be wondering how to become one. These are several things that you can do to work in this field.

1. Have a relevant degree

If you want to start your career as a big data engineer, you need to master the required skills. It means that you should have a related education. People will see you as highly qualified people if you own a degree in a data-related field.

Companies also will be more convinced if you have a related educational background. People who work as big data engineers usually have bachelor’s, master’s, or higher degrees in a related field.

For instance, they may get a degree in computer science, data analytics, physics, software engineering, applied math, or statistics. It is because this position needs to master data, statistics, and coding. Numerous companies minimally recruit people with bachelor’s degrees to work as big data engineers.

The higher your degree is, the bigger opportunity for you to get accepted. It means that you want to work in this position seriously.

2. Consider certifications

Having a related degree is not enough, you can be more qualified by considering joining certified courses. Getting professional certifications is beneficial to secure your position. Besides, it helps you learning relevant skills and later apply them in your working area.

There are various courses with related areas of work like machine learning, cloud computing, data analytics, and software development that you can choose from. By getting certifications in those working areas, it will be easier for you to convince people about your quality of work.

You will get more recognition as a qualified big data engineer with the proofs from certifications you have obtained.

3. Get work experience

To get a job as a big data engineer, you commonly need to have some previous work experience. Having experience in a related field is a key asset to obtaining a job. You can start by practicing the skills independently and start to join some internships in the associated field.

After getting experience through internships, you can try freelancing jobs. As you get used to the tasks, you can improve the work responsibilities by starting to officially work in data-related field. There are various positions you can try such as data analyst or software developer.

The more experience you have, the better your chances to get a job as a big data engineer. Besides, having many experiences in the associated field can make your portfolio more convincing.

4. Get used to databases

Databases are a fundamental thing when it comes to big data architectures. Along with learning the theory about it, you have to practice using it. You start by familiarizing yourself with big data tools such as SQL and Python. You can start working with database management systems too such as MySQL.

5. Develop some related skills

As a big data engineer, there are numerous tools that you can use to support your work. Although you do not need to master all of the skills, learning about them will help you understand more about your work. When you learn them, at least you will know how to use each tool in your working area properly.

You will have an idea of how the tool interacts with each other. Improving yourself with broader skills allows people to see your exceptional quality. It means you are passionate and deserve for this position.

Sometimes you can get new jobs when improving yourself with the required skills. It proves the broader skills you have mastered, the bigger network you can build.

6. Open yourself to job opportunities

Frequently, a person who works as a big data engineer starts their career from different roles in a related field. They might work as data analysts, data professionals, software developers, or rely on an academic route. When you are still early in career, you need to open yourself to various job opportunities.

As long as they are still in the related field, it is beneficial to help yourself grow. There are various jobs associated with data engineering. Working on those positions for several years will bring you to your dream career as a big data engineer.

Although data engineering is currently as not as popular as other data-related roles, it can be a prospective job and highly rewarding in the future. Over time, people will start to notice the importance of a big data engineer role as big data keep expanding from year to year.

If you consider this position for your career in the future, it is important to prepare yourself by learning the required skills and getting a related education degree. Enrich yourself with experience in the data field and try to work on some projects. It helps you to earn a better living from this position.

Read More:

Related Posts